Gate Drivers+Microchip Technology+TC4424EOE713 Overview
Introducing the TC4424EOE713 from Microchip Technology, a robust low-side gate driver designed to enhance the efficiency and performance of your power management systems. This driver is ideally suited for driving MOSFETs and IGBTs, facilitating rapid switching with reduced power dissipation and improved overall system reliability. With its dual outputs and matched propagation delays, the TC4424EOE713 ensures synchronous operation, making it a preferred choice for high-frequency power switching applications.
TC4424EOE713 Features
The TC4424EOE713 gate driver is distinguished by its high peak output current of up to 3A, dual independent channels, and low shoot-through current. It operates over a wide supply voltage range from 4.5V to 18V, providing versatile compatibility with various circuit designs. Its robust design includes protection features such as latch-up immunity and ESD protection, ensuring device and system stability under harsh conditions.
TC4424EOE713 Applications
- DC-DC Converters: Enhances efficiency by driving the switches at high frequencies with minimal delay and loss.
- Motor Control Systems: Used to drive the gate of MOSFETs or IGBTs in motor controllers, providing precise control over motor speed and torque.
- Power Management Modules: Facilitates robust power regulation, ensuring reliable operation of power management circuits in consumer electronics.
- LED Lighting Systems: Drives switching components in LED drivers, optimizing light output and maximizing energy efficiency.
